James C. Cunningham

September 14, 1954 — January 10, 2020

James C. Cunningham, 65, of Austintown passed away on Friday evening, January 10, 2020 at St. Elizabeth Hospital Boardman Campus. Jim was born September 14, 1954 in Youngstown the son of the late Norman and Janice (Bott) Cunningham. He was a lifelong area resident, a graduate of Austintown Fitch High School, class of 1972 and received his associate degree from Youngstown State University in 1986. Jim retired in 2019 from Highway Equipment Company where he was their Safety Manager. Jim was the first 3rd generation family member to serve as Master of Sincerity Lodge #694 of the Masons which later became part of the Niles McKinley Lodge #794. As a Mason Jim was a member of all 3 bodies of York Rite, where he received the Knights of the York Cross of Honor. Jim loved music and was a drummer at heart. He was a founding member and president of the Warren Junior Military Band Alumni Association and was a member of the Canfield Community Band. He also enjoyed classic rock music, traveling, muscle cars, drag racing, and NASCAR. One of the highlights of Jim’s life was attending the Bristol Motor Speedway. He also enjoyed following the Cleveland Indians and the Green Bay Packers.
